She gazed into her mirror

And beheld an aging face…

The woman looking back at her

Seemed strangely out of place.

Time, wily thief, had stolen gold

And left her only gray…

She touched with rueful fingers

Lines that would not smooth away.

Lost in wistful contemplation

She was really unaware

As the door behind her opened

With her husband standing there.

Are you ready yet, my darlin’?

Lady, aren’t you a sight…

I can see why blue’s your color!

Girl, you’ll knock ‘em dead tonight!

With started gaze she met his eyes

Reflected in the glass…

And as he smiled the strangest thing

Of all had come to pass.

It may have been a change of light

But gray returned to gold…

And the woman in the mirror now looked

Young instead of old!

–Helen V. Christensen
